NTAP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

497 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NetApp (NTAP)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$8.41B — down 36% from $13.2B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 102 funds closed out of NTAP and 59 opened new positions — a net loss of 43 holders — while 199 trimmed existing stakes and 161 added.

The largest buyer was VOYA Investment Management, adding an estimated $55M. The largest seller was Renaissance Technologies, cutting an estimated $113M.
